Cory Hill, Brookline, MA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cory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Cory Hill | $2,329 | $1,495 | $4,950 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$2,747 | $960 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$3,456 | $1,350 | $8,350 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$4,064 | $1,395 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$4,895 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$5,673 | $2,850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Cory Hill | $7,025 | $4,700 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Cory Hill
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Cory Hill?
Actualmente hay 349 Apartamentos Estudios en Cory Hill con alquileres que van desde $1,495 hasta $4,950, con un precio medio de $2,329.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Cory Hill?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Cory Hill varian entre $960 y $12,504 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,747
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Cory Hill?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Cory Hill van desde $1,350 hasta $8,350.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,456
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Cory Hill?
En estos momentos hay 583 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Cory Hill en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,395 y $13,207 - con una media de $4,064 para el lugar.
